Oracle has figured out a neat trick for building one of the largest data center networks on the planet: get the customers to pay for it upfront. In its fiscal first quarter ending August 31, 2026, the company collected $11.36 billion in customer prepayments, a sum that covered a significant chunk of its $28.5 billion in capital expenditures for the period. The arrangement is working. Cloud infrastructure revenue more than doubled year-over-year, climbing 121% to $7.4 billion. Total cloud revenue hit $11.6 billion, a 62% increase. And the pipeline keeps growing, with Oracle booking over $30 billion in new AI cloud contracts during the quarter alone. The prepay playbook Oracle’s remaining performance obligations, essentially its backlog of contracted future revenue, surged to $664 billion. That figure represents an extraordinary runway of committed spending from customers who have already signed on the dotted line. The company delivered 850 megawatts of new data center capacity during the quarter and supplied more than 300,000 GPUs to AI clients.
